Oct 21, 2013 · Using a within-subject design, 48 subjects with dyslexia read 12 texts with 12 different fonts. Sans serif, monospaced and roman font styles significantly improved the reading performance over ... What is missing… is scientific evidence that special dyslexia fonts are actually better for dyslexic readers than commonly used fonts.”. So, despite efforts to tailor fonts for people with dyslexia, default system fonts such as Arial, Minion, and Verdana turn out to be equally legible in most cases. Verdana (Google Docs & Microsoft Word) Verdana is arguably one of the best Fonts for Dyslexia in Google Docs and Microsoft Word. It’s a humanist sans-serif font that was launched in 1996, and it was designed by Matthew Carter. The unique thing about Verdana font is that it was designed to be readable even on small screens with low resolution. OpenDyslexic: OpenDyslexic is a widely recognized font specifically designed for individuals with dyslexia. It features weighted bottoms, which helps to provide a visual anchor and prevent letters from flipping or rotating. The unique design of this font aims to decrease reading ...Based on research, the best paper colors for dyslexia are those that have a warm tint, which can reduce visual stress and improve reading speed. Cream-colored paper is a popular choice because it has a warm tint and is easy on the eyes. Light green and light blue paper can also be effective for reducing visual stress and improving reading speed.The reason why Papyrus is one of the worst fonts for Dyslexia is its design. However, mounting evidence divulges that presentation of the text has a great bearing on the accessibility of information for Dyslexic children.Both Dyslexie, and Open Dyslexic claim that they make reading ‘easier’ for people with dyslexia. The evidence that such fonts make reading easier is inconclusive, with limited research having been done on these types of weighted fonts in particular. Choose a simple font. Keep the font clear and simple. Evenly spaced sans serif fonts, such as Arial tend to be easier to read for people with dyslexia. There are many alternatives, including Verdana, Tahoma, Century Gothic and Trebuchet. Avoid condensed and cursive fonts.Best Fonts for Dyslexia .
